Abstract
PURPOSE:To obtain a photoreceptor in a long wavelength region for use in a semiconductor laser beam printer, by laminating an interlayer for allowing photocharge carriers to pass it, and a photoconductive layer made of amorphous silicon formed by blow discharge on a conductive substrate. CONSTITUTION:An interlayer consisting of CdS.nCdCO3 powder and a thermosetting resin is formed on a substrate 23. This interlayer has >=10<13>OMEGA.cm resistivity and 10-70mum thickness capable of transmitting photocharge carriers. An amorphous silicon layer is formed on the interlayer by glow discharge in SiH4, oxygen, hydrogen, etc. fed from material gas tanks 1-4 in a reaction tube 21. This silicon layer is 0.5-10mum thick, and this photoreceptor is sensitive to the wavelength range from the longer visible light wavelength to the near-infrared region.
